BeeBee30 wrote:
What is interesting is there seems to me to be potential to make free hubs that are not Dura Ace 11 compatible work?


Sure, if the hub has a DS flange that's far enough in and the hub leaves enough room. Monchito started with a Mavic hub which already has an extra spacer to run Shimano cassettes. Hubs that can fit Campy freehubs without redishing would be the best bet.

I expect to see Sram 11sp in a year or so. It'd be great if it was just a new ratchet.
